| The Mature Workers Alliance of Puget Sound is a
group of public and private organizations dedicated to empowering
mature workers (age 50+) and the community to increase their productive
and meaningful presence of age and experience in the workforce.
These are
the organizations that form the Mature Workers Alliance:
AARP
Boeing Reemployment Team
Boeing Career Transition Center
IAM/Boeing Quality Through Training Program
City of Seattle Human Services Department, Mayor’s Office for Senior Citizens (MOSC)
National Asian Pacific Center on Aging (NAPCA)
Senior Community Service Employment Program
Senior Environmental Employment Program
Pacific Associates
Puget Sound Career Development Association
Seattle Center Productions
Senior Services of Seattle-King
County
State of Washington Employment Security Department
Urban Enterprise Center WA-Greater Seattle Chamber of Commerce/Business & Solutions Unit
Trade Adjustment Act
U.S. Department of Health &
Human Services, Administration on Aging
U.S. Department of Labor
Office of the Secretary
Employment & Training Administration
Women’s Bureau
U.S. Small Business
Administration in Seattle
Service Corps of Retired Executives (SCORE) in Seattle
State of Washington Small Business Development Center
Volt Services Group
Workforce Development Council of
Seattle-King County
WorkSource Seattle-King County
YWCA of Seattle, King County, and Snohomish County
